We are thrilled to announce the publication of Humane Genomics’ first article. We contributed a chapter to the International Review of Cell and Molecular Biology (IRCMB). This is a book series by Elsevier, as part of a special issue on Viral Vectors in Cancer Immunotherapy. Our review, titled “Rational selection of an ideal oncolytic virus to address current limitations in clinical translation,” offers valuable insights for investors, virologists, and newcomers to the field alike. We were thrilled to present a poster of our work at AACR. It is one of the biggest conferences on cancer research, with 22,000 visitors. To get accepted, we had to write an abstract, which was reviewed, and we needed to be sponsored by an existing member. For us this was Dr. Sanjeev Vasudevan, whom we work with at Texas Children’s.
